    Let G0 and G1 be two graphs with the same vertices.The new graph G(G0,G1;M)is agraph with the vertex set V(G0)∪V(G1)and the edge set E(G0)∪E(G1)∪M,where M is an arbitraryperfect matching between the vertices of G0 and G1,i.e.,a set of cross edges with one endvertex in G0 and the other endvertex in G1.In this paper,we will show that if G0 and G1 are f-fault q-panconnected,then for any f≥2,G(G0,G1;M)is(f+1)-fault(q+2)-panconnected.

    Consider the oscillatory hyper-Hilbert transformHn,α,βf(x)=∫10f(x-Γ(t))eit-βt-1-αdt (1)along the curveΓ(t)=(tp1,tp2,...,tpn),whereβ>α≥0 and 0<p1<p2<···<pn.We prove that Hn,α,βis bounded on L2 if and only ifβ≥(n+1)α.Our work extends and improves some known results.

    Let σk(G)denote the minimum degree sum of k independent vertices in G andα(G)denotethe number of the vertices of a maximum independent set of G.In this paper we prove that if G is a4-connected graph of order n andσ5(G)≥n+3α(G)+11,then G is Hamiltonian.

    Let s:S2G(2,5)be a linearly full totally unramified pseudo-holomorphic curve withconstant Gaussian curvature K in a complex Grassmann manifold G(2,5).It is prove that K is either1/2 or 4/5 if s is non-±holomorphic.Furthermore, K=1/2 if and only if s is totally real. We also provethat the Gaussian curvature K is either 1 or 4/3 if s is a non-degenerate holomorphic curve under someconditions.

    In this paper,a Z4-equivariant quintic planar vector field is studied.The Hopf bifurcationmethod and polycycle bifurcation method are combined to study the limit cycles bifurcated fromthe compounded cycle with 4 hyperbolic saddle points.It is found that this special quintic planarpolynomial system has at least four large limit cycles which surround all singular points.By applyingthe double homoclinic loops bifurcation method and Hopf bifurcation method,we conclude that 28limit cycles with two different configurations exist in this special planar polynomial system.Theresults acquired in this paper are useful for studying the weakened 16th Hilbert's Problem.
